What Are the Most Common Causes of Neck Pain?

Your cervical spine runs through your neck and contains seven vertebrae. Its purpose is to support the weight of your head, as well as turn it in nearly any possible direction. However, the neck’s flexibility is also what makes it so vulnerable to strain, often resulting in neck pain. Some of the more common causes include:

  • Injury: Any incident that forces a sudden movement of the head or neck is likely to result in some degree of strain. The resulting damage to the muscles, spine, ligaments, or nerves can easily result in acute or chronic neck pain.
  • Lifestyle Choices: Sedentary lifestyle choices, obesity, and bad posture can all add up to chronic neck and back pain over the years.
  • Aging: Many conditions associated with advancing years can cause neck pain if they are severe. Examples include arthritis, spinal stenosis, and osteoporosis.

There are also many diseases and medical conditions that can come with neck pain as a symptom. A chiropractor can help with all of these possibilities.

How Will Your Chiropractor Treat Your Neck Pain?

Our chiropractor will start by attempting to identify the root cause of your neck pain. In addition to examining you physically, he will ask you various questions to get an idea of when the pain started. He will also ask about the nature of your pain, as well as what treatments you’ve already tried. At that point, he will discuss possible courses of neck pain treatment. All possibilities are non-invasive and include options like:

  • Spinal adjustment and manipulations of the cervical vertebrae
  • Therapeutic massage
  • Rehabilitative movements, stretches, and exercises

Your specific treatment program may include just one of those or several of them depending on your personal needs, the causes of your pain, and other factors regarding your current level of health.
